Essex was a constituency represented in the House of Commons of the Parliament of the United Kingdom from 1290 until 1832. It elected two MPs to the House of Commons and was divided into two single member constituencies (Essex North and Essex South) in the Great Reform Act.

Members of Parliament

1290-1660

* 1399, 1413: John Doreward, twice Speaker of the House of Commons
* 1523-?: Thomas Audley
* 1601-1628: Sir Francis Barrington
* 1614: Sir Richard Weston
* 1626: Sir Harbottle Grimston
* 1628-1629: Sir Harbottle Grimston
* 1629: Lord Rich
* 1640: Sir Thomas Barrington
* 1640-1653: Sir William Masham
* 1640-1641: Lord Rich
* 1641-1648: Sir Martin Lumley
* 1654-1655: Sir William Masham
* 1656-1658: Sir Harbottle Grimston
* 1659: Lord Rich
